I don't know if I would call 20 points on 21 shots coming through as the #1 guy. We probably have a few people who would score that many points with that many shots. Williams has been terribly inefficient this year and we can't have our game go through him if we want to keep winning games.

Williams is averaging lower 2p%, 3p%, FT%, assists, DRB, ORB, and blocks than last year. He also has almost .5 more turnovers and fouls a game. The only thing he's better in is steals which is by .1
